96. What You Will Find in Jesus

1 What will you find in Jesus?
A Refuge from alarm;
A help in time of trouble,
A shelter from the storm.

Chorus:
This you will find in Jesus,
A very Friend indeed;
A Comforter and Savior—
The very Friend you need.

2 What will you find in Jesus?
A Savior from all sin!
A rest from condemnation,
And peace and joy within. [Chorus]

3 What will you find in Jesus?
A Friend in time of need!
The truest, best, most faithful—
A very Friend indeed. [Chorus]

4 What will you find in Jesus?
The grace to help you on
Amid life’s great temptations,
‘Till heaven’s crown is won. [Chorus]

Text Information
First Line: What will you find in Jesus
Title: What You Will Find in Jesus
Author: Rev. E. A. Hoffman
Refrain First Line: This you will find in Jesus
Language: English
Publication Date: 1904
Tune Information
Name: [What will you find in Jesus]
Composer: Chas. K. Langley
